Abstract
The electrical conductivities of dodecamolybdophosphoric acid H3Mo12PO40·29H2O and dodecatungstophosphoric acid H3W12PO40·29H2O crystals were measured. Remarkably high conductivities of 0.18 and 0.17 mho cm−1 at 25°C, and low activation energies of 15.5 and 13.7 kJ/mol were observed for the former and the latter, respectively.This publication has 3 references indexed in Scilit:
